About Geoffrey Wynne RI
Geoffrey Wynne (Stoke-on-Trent, England) starts his artistic studies being a child at the prestigious Portland House Art School, afterwards he goes to the Burslem School Of Art finishing his Fine Art studies at Staffordshire University.
Like many British painters and watercolorists, as Apperley, Jonh S. Sargent and Stanier, he travels to Spain attracted by its romanticism and beauty. He has been living in Granada since 1988. Geoffrey Wynne has won a large amount of awards and distinctions during his career and recently he has become a member of the prestigious "Royal Institute of Painters in Watercolours".

Geoffrey Wynne RI Work Experience
Professional Activities
1987 to date move to Spain, professional Watercolour painter
themes are urban landscapes, the colour and life of Andalucia, Morocco, Portugal and Venice
1995 to date teaching twice weekly private classes in studio for up to 15 students per class
1995 to date weekend outdoor painting classes
